Certificate II in Automotive Technology Studies
(Mechanical Pre-Apprenticeship)

This VET program:
- provides participants with the knowledge and skills to achieve competencies that will enhance their employment prospects in the automotive or automotive-related industries.
- enables participants to gain a recognised credential and to make informed choices relating to vocation and career paths.
Sample Modules (Units 1 - 4)
- Job seeking skills
- Carry out industry research
- Apply safe work practices
- Operate electrical test equipment
- Recharge batteries
- Use and maintain workplace tools and equipment
- Dismantle and assemble transmission, manual
- Remove and replace wheel and tyre assemblies
- Remove and replace cylinder head
- Dismantle and assemble carburetor
- Dismantle and assemble 4-stroke multi-cylinder engine
- Dismantle and assemble fuel pump
- Remove and replace radiator
- Remove and replace clutch assembly
- Remove and replace suspension, front springs
- Construct basic electronic circuits
Future Pathways
- Certificate III in Automotive (Electrical)
- Certificate III in Automotive Mechanical (Automatic Transmission)
- Certificate III in Automotive Electrical Technology
- Certificate III in Automotive Mechanical Technology (Light Vehicle)
- Certificate III in Automotive Mechanical (Motor Cycle)
- Certificate III in Automotive (Vehicle Body - Panel Beating)
Future Career Opportunities
- Light vehicle motor mechanic
- Vehicle service person
